Internship Report on Tuesday, May 21st at 12:00

NEW DATE: On Tuesday, May 21st, Elly Schmid will present her internship at 12:00 in seminar room 3, John-Skilton-Str. 4a. :

From the abstract:

The internship was carried out as part of the HEATS-(Urban heat) Project of the Georisks team at the Earth Observation Center, which deals with the quantification of urban heat exposure through high-resolution remote sensing. Her tasks included data processing and additional data acquisition. The main goal was to develop an object-based image segmentation and classification of the urban research area for later integration into a land use regression approach. Elly will report on the tasks she worked on and on her overall experience during the internship.

Hosting Institution; Georisks Team at DLR – Deutsches Zentrum für Luft- und Raumfahrt

Supervisor: Dr. Maninder Singh Dhillon
